Overview

Signals answer why now—company updates, event activity, municipal changes, and BD review prompts—so your team does not rely on memory alone. For BD and marketing leads, a short weekly signals pass is often the fastest way to turn a contact list into outreach with context.

When to use this

  • Monday standup: Skim what changed on target accounts and stale relationships.
  • Before a developer or owner call: Confirm there is a recent reason to reference beyond “checking in.”
  • After a conference: Tie event activity back to people you met or firms on your shortlist.

Steps

Open Signals from the workspace sidebar (under Win work in docs).

Scan for items tied to accounts or contacts you already care about.

Open the signal, verify the source, then log activity or schedule follow-up—do not send automated outreach without review.

Dismiss noise aggressively; a short weekly review beats an overflowing feed.

Signals support proactive BD—they do not guarantee accuracy. Confirm on the source link before referencing in email. AI summaries are draft for review.
